At a brokerage meeting in Mesa, a homeowner thinks ADRE decides who qualifies for property-tax relief and exemptions. Which outcome best matches current Arizona practice?

Correct Answer

A) property-tax administration and many relief applications are handled through Arizona tax authorities and county officials rather than ADRE

Under Arizona Department of Revenue materials, property-tax administration and many relief applications are handled through Arizona tax authorities and county officials rather than ADRE.
